久久r热视频,国产午夜精品一区二区三区视频,亚洲精品自拍偷拍,欧美日韩精品二区

您的位置:首頁技術文章
文章詳情頁

python - asyncio.wait和asyncio.gather的區別?

瀏覽:118日期:2022-08-27 09:17:38

問題描述

剛學PYTHON的協程,我想請教下,這兩段代碼執行起來有什么區別呢?

tasks = [asyncio.ensure_future(task(i)) for i in range(0,300)]loop.run_until_complete(asyncio.gather(*tasks))tasks = [task(i) for i in range(0,300)]loop.run_until_complete(asyncio.wait(tasks))

問題解答

回答1:

看文檔就知道了,這兩段代碼的效果相同。但是 wait 和 gather 的返回值不一樣,wait 也可以在第一個 future 完全或者出錯時就返回。

回答2:

RTFM......

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 文水县| 望江县| 昆山市| 个旧市| 勐海县| 正宁县| 图木舒克市| 东辽县| 兴文县| 修水县| 大城县| 比如县| 赞皇县| 和平县| 肇源县| 合山市| 确山县| 龙里县| 崇礼县| 彝良县| 九台市| 卫辉市| 黄龙县| 吴忠市| 三门县| 聊城市| 古蔺县| 湾仔区| 察隅县| 叶城县| 晋中市| 南郑县| 保靖县| 金寨县| 辉南县| 德庆县| 阳曲县| 衡东县| 博罗县| 环江| 固始县|